Subject: FORGIVEN

Benny got his pet husky for his 10th birthday, and he was estatic about it, but as time grew
on, Benny got used to the dog, and started to ignore him. He had always wanted to play
catch, and take him for a walk, but all they did in the 5 months was play in the grass, never
doing any of the things Benny wanted. Benny named his dog cammy, thinking of the dog he
had always seen in his mind, he begged and worried his parents to get him a dog, and they
finally did. When cammy first came home, all Benny wanted to do is play with his new friend,
but when his friends came over, he abandoned cammy for them.
Benny always felt guilty about leaving cammy alone, but at this time in his life, he thought his
human friends were more important. Cammy would always have a sad frown on his face,
whining like a rat, then turning away from Benny and his friends. The friends he had weren’t
interested in dogs, all they wanted to do was play football, and baseball, and Benny could
never say no. When he came home after being with his friends all day, he would pet cammy’s
brown and white fur, cammy seemed happy to finally get his attention, but knew it wouldn’t
last long, because tommorrow, Benny would be gone again, and he would be alone.
Benny’s parents didn’t want the dog in the house, so he would always sit him out
at nighttime, cammy would whine sadly, but to no avail. After the first five months were over,
Benny totally ignored his furry friend, joining a little league baseball team, and being gone till
night. By the time he got home, the dog was tied in the backyard, and Benny was too exhausted
to notice him. He would always hear cammy howling at night, but thought nothing of it, maybe
he was just yawning Benny thought, no one was able to see cammy’s lonliness.

One day, cammy’s lease was left untied, and he wandered off into the neighborhood, crawled
to the middle of the road, and sat there. Several cars had just barley missed him, but cammy
didn’t budge, he just sat there, as if he wanted to be hit. Then a UPS truck came down the
road, and couldn’t see cammy laying in the road, it ran over him, and crushed his lower abdomen, exposing his organs slightly on the road. Nobody noticed the dog being hit, and he
never let out any scream, he just sat there and died.
Benny came home at 5:30 that evening, he had just relized how much he had been ignoring
cammy, and vowed to spend all of his time with him. He went to the backyard running, expecting to see cammy glaring at him with those big black eyes, but cammy was nowhere to
be seen. Benny came screaming to his parents that his dog was missing, they all immediately
searched for cammy, he wasn’t in the house, not in the toolshed, he had dissapeared.
Benny ran down the street screaming cammy’s name, but got no response. Then as he reached
the turn of the corner, he saw an apauling site, there was cammy, with some of his guts laying
out of his body. Benny was speechless, he just stood there, tears immediately started poring
down his face, cammy was gone, just when he was about to start spending his time with him,
he was gone. Benny went home crying, and told his parents about it, they comforted him, and
told him they would get another dog, but Benny said he didn’t want another one, and went to
his room for the night.

All night, Benny cried and told cammy how sorry he was for ignoring him, and how he wish he
could stroke his fur. All night he kept saying, “forgive me cammy, please forgive me”. At 4:30
am, Benny heard a loud scratch at his window, he got up to investigate it, but there was nothing
there. Then a ball came flying out of the trees, a baseball, it seemed to come from nowhere,
Benny cried out, “cammy is that you”, a loud bark came into the air, but there was no dog in
sight. He followed the sound of the bark, and played with an invisible friend.
The next morning, Benny’s father woke him up, and asked him why was he sleeping outside,Benny smiled and said, “cammy wanted to play catch”.
